WebMar 6, 2024 · ATP hydrolysis results in phosphorylation of aspartate residue of pump. ADP is released Phosphorylated pump undergoes conformational change to expose Na+ ions to exterior of cell. Na+ ions are released. Pump binds 2 extracellular K+ ions. Pump dephosphorylates causing it to expose K+ ions to cytoplasm as pump returns to original … bingo in ft myers

WebCells use ATP to perform work by coupling ATP hydrolysis’ exergonic reaction with endergonic reactions. ATP donates its phosphate group to another molecule via phosphorylation. The phosphorylated molecule is at a higher-energy state and is less stable than its unphosphorylated form, and this added energy from phosphate allows the …
